#10F130 Hex Color Code

#10F130

The Hexadecimal Color #10F130 is a contrast shade of Lime Green. #10F130 RGB value is rgb(16, 241, 48). RGB Color Model of #10F130 consists of 6% red, 94% green and 18% blue. HSL color Mode of #10F130 has 129°(degrees) Hue, 89% Saturation and 50% Lightness. #10F130 color has an wavelength of 538.77778n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#10F130 is #33FF33.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#10F130 is #1E3. The Closest Color to #10F130 is #32CD32. Official Name of #10F130 Hex Code is Green.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#10F130 is 93 Cyan 0 Magenta 80 Yellow 5 Black and #10F130 CMY is 93, 0, 80.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#10F130 is hsl(129,89,50,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(129, 93, 95).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#10F130 is 32.2, 63.23, 13.3.
Hex8 Value of #10F130 is #10F130FF. Decimal Value of #10F130 is 1110320 and Octal Value of #10F130 is 4170460. Binary Value of #10F130 is 10000, 11110001, 110000 and Android of #10F130 is 4279300400 / 0xff10f130.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#10F130 is 0.296, 0.582, 0.582 and YIQ Color Space of #10F130 is 151.723, -72.0666, -107.6491.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#10F130 is 48.6, 84.76, 14.04.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#10F130 is 83.56, -80.59, 72.43.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#10F130 is 83.56, -77.82, 96.97.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#10F130 is 83.56, 108.36, 138.05. Hunter Lab variable of #10F130 is 79.52, -66.87, 45.75.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#10F130

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
